About The Role
As a Principal Engineer you will work closely with clients, responsible for the successful delivery of client and internal projects through building professional relationships with key client stakeholders, challenging where appropriate, and using your technical expertise to set and provide best practice advice and processes within your project team and wider capability.
What You’ll Be Doing
* Technical Strategy & Leadership: Defines and implements technical strategies, ensuring best practices in architecture, security, and quality throughout all engineering and client projects.
* Engineering Leadership: Acts as Lead Engineer on client projects, overseeing RFPs and BIDs while collaborating with the sales team for effective execution.
* Consultancy & Business Growth: Applies a growth mindset, identifies revenue opportunities, and collaborates with the commercial team to secure additional work.
* Knowledge & Capability Development: Serves as a subject matter expert, mentors engineers, and is responsible for ensuring the engineering capability’s skills and development aligns with client needs and market trends.
* Pre-Sales & Client Engagement: Leading engineering contributions in pre-sales, determines client requirements, and represents CreateFuture through events, speaking, and blogging.
* Emerging Technologies & Industry Influence: Stays ahead of industry trends, contributes to thought leadership, and enhances Create Future’s reputation through public engagements.
* Team Leadership & Culture: Fosters a collaborative, inclusive, and psychologically safe environment, advocating for team growth and organisational values.
We’d love to talk to you if you have:
* Proven experience as a technical leader, balancing hands-on technical skills with client delivery and stakeholder management expertise.
* Strong ability to build client relationships, understand their challenges, and provide effective solutions across technical and project management aspects.
* Demonstrable expertise in your chosen technologies, with the ability to mentor and grow the skills of groups of engineers. Ideally, you have an industry presence in your technology passions.
* Commercial experience with one or more technical stacks: Java, C# .NET, .NET Core, Typescript (Backend/Frontend), React, NodeJS, and modern cloud infrastructure (ideally AWS or Azure).
* You are experienced in contributing to sales and shaping how engagements are delivered in a consultancy setting.

Our Interview Process
* 30-minute call with one of our Talent Acquisition Team.
* 60-minute Technical Consultancy Interview.
* 30-minute Take Home review or 60-minute Live Coding exercise plus a 60-minute Values interview.
Our interview process is designed as an opportunity both for our interviewers to learn about your expertise, interests and motivations and for you to gain insights into the role, team and business as a whole, so throughout the process, you’ll meet a few people from our team as well as others from across the business to help you get a well-rounded view of the role and life at CreateFuture.
